Paul E. Havens (1839-1913) family

Scope and Contents

The Havens papers contain a small number of business papers, deeds, and records of Frey family ancestry, but they primarily consist of personal family letters from the late 1800s. They include the correspondence of Paul Havens' parents, Havens' correspondence with his wife and daughters, and letters from his siblings and their children. Included are many letters written by Havens' daughter Eleanor "Lollie" while attending the Art Students' League of New York. Letters from his daughter Elizabeth include one written on the day of her wedding to Daniel Read Anthony, Jr.

Incoming letters are arranged by name of correspondent, subarranged chronologically. Papers that postdate Paul Havens' death are chiefly those from his widow's estate.

Also included in the Paul E. Havens papers are various books and periodicals from the family library.
